‘A case study in groupthink’: were liberals wrong about the pandemic?

In Covid ’s Wake: How Our Politics Failed Us , Stephen Macedo and Frances Lee argue that public health authorities, the mainstream media, and progressive elites often pushed pandemic measures without weighing their costs and benefits.
The book grew out of research Macedo was doing on the ways progressive discourse gets handicapped by a refusal to engage with conservative or outside arguments.
Reports by Johns Hopkins , World Health Organization , Illinois and British government had expressed ambivalence or caution about the kind of quarantine measures that were soon taken.
Johns Hopkins Center for Health Security hosted a wargaming exercise in October 2019 , shortly before the pandemic began, to simulate a deadly coronavirus pandemic.
Dr Anthony Fauci and other top public health figures were evasive or in some cases dishonest about the possibility of a lab leak, Macedo and Lee say.
Since then, the CIA and other US intelligence agencies have cautiously endorsed the lab leak theory.
The reception to In Covid’s Wake has been more positive than they expected perhaps a sign their arguments have penetrated the mainstream.
